文章詳目資料

International Journal of Electronic Commerce Studies Scopus

  • 加入收藏
  • 下載文章
篇名 ACHIEVING 100 GB/S URL FILTERING WITH COTS MULTI-CORE SYSTEMS
卷期 8:1
作者 Surachai ChitpinityonSurasak SanguanpongSupaporn ErjongmaneeKasom Koht-Arsa
頁次 077-096
關鍵字 URL FilteringWeb FilteringSession Hijacking100 GbECOTSAVL
出刊日期 201706
DOI 10.7903/ijecs.1483

中文摘要

英文摘要

URL filtering is an essential tool used by Internet Service Providers (ISPs) and organizations to restrain clients from accessing non-secured or illegal web content. Designing a URL filtering method that achieves a high bit rate of 100 Gb/s and beyond for international ISPs is a challenging task. High-performance URL filtering with multi-gigabit rate capacity requires a fast URL matching algorithm and an enhanced packet processing technique. In this paper, we tackle these challenges by design and development of a software-based URL filtering system to support 100 Gb/s bandwidth. Our aim is to build a system that runs on a single commercial off-the-shelf (COTS) server with multi-core CPUs. We propose a compact URL representation using AVL tree and a multi-core/multi-thread filtering technique with session hijacking and fast packet processing framework. Performance measurements results show successful URL filtering operating at 100 Gb/s in a real network testbed.

相關文獻